Preparation

First, let’s get our pizza dough prepped. Slice it into 8-10 pieces – you can make them as big or small as you want. Pro tip: spraying your knife with cooking spray will help prevent the dough from sticking, making your life a whole lot easier.

Once that’s done, we’ll move on to the boiling process.

In a large pot, bring 6 cups of water and 1/4 cup of baking soda to a boil. This is the step that gives those pretzels their signature texture. When the water is bubbling, carefully submerge each piece of dough for about a minute.

After that, place them on a greased cookie sheet and get ready to bake.

Cooking

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it while the dough is boiling. Once you’ve got all the pretzel pieces on the cookie sheet, pop them in the oven for 15 minutes. You’ll want to keep an eye on them as they bake – they should turn a beautiful golden brown.

While they’re baking, it’s time to whip up that creamy cheese sauce. Start by melting some butter in a saucepan, then mix in flour and let it cook for a minute while stirring continuously. Gradually add in your two cups of milk, and keep stirring until it thickens.

That’s when the magic happens! Once it’s nice and thick, stir in the cheddar, mustard, and seasoning. Let it simmer on low and stir often until everything is melted and warmed through.

When the pretzels come out of the oven, dip them in melted butter and sprinkle with flaky salt. They should look golden, crispy, and absolutely irresistible!

Pretzels and Mustard Cheese

Print Pin Rate
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 25 minutes
Total Time: 40 minutes
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• Cooking spray
  • One tube pizza crust
  • 3 tbs butter
  • 3 tbs flour
  • 2 cups milk
  • 2 cups cheddar
  • 1 stick butter for dipping
  • Flaky salt
  • 1 tbs AP seasoning( killer hogs )
  • 1/4 cup your favorite mustard ( I used a sweet heat )
  • 6 cups of water
  • 1/4 cup baking soda

Instructions

  • Bring water and baking soda to a boil. In the meantime slice your pizza dough into 8-10 pieces . If you spray your knife with cooking spray it will keep it from sticking .once water is boiling submerge your dough slices for about a minute each . Remove and place on grease cookie sheet . Bake at 400 degrees Fahrenheit for 15 minutes . Make cheese sauce while waiting . Melt butter mix in flour. Let cook for a minute stirring continuously. Then slowly add two cups of milk . Once simmering and thick . Add cheese , mustard and seasoning . Let that simmer on low stirring often , till cheese is melted and warmed through . Once rolls are done dip in butter and sprinkle with salt . Then enjoy
